PyAstronomy What is it? ----------- PyAstronomy is a collection of astronomy-related packages written in Python. Currently, the following subpackages are available: funcFit: A convenient fitting package providing support for minimization and MCMC sampling. modelSuite: A Set of astrophysical models (e.g., transit light-curve modeling), which can be used stand-alone or with funcFit. AstroLib: A set of useful routines including a number of ports from IDL's astrolib. Constants: The package provides a number of often-needed constants. Timing: Provides algorithms for timing analysis such as the Lomb-Scargle and the Generalized Lomb-Scargle periodogram pyaGUI: A collection of GUI tools for interactive work. Installation ------------ Use "python setup.py [--with-ext] install" If you specify the --with-ext flag, setup will try to compile non-Python modules. This is not mandatory.
